Output 28513ca40d3c10530349711a27f4c0c60b202af220953eb186fe866e8480a2e7:3

value
53478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0810c015e701716f2cb250f9e146102dbd50612c OP_EQUAL
address
32RfPurHu9hEx7A94Rne9fkfUpj7MGb1vX
transaction
28513ca40d3c10530349711a27f4c0c60b202af220953eb186fe866e8480a2e7
spent
true